| Oakland's Children's
Hospital |
| The Children's Hospital Medical Center of Northern California provides a full range of pediatric acute and intensive care services to residents in the East Bay and throughout Northern California. |
| When Hospital recently expanded its facilities and services, the Authority helped with $65 million in tax-exempt financing. This capital project replaced an existing helipad, expanded pediatric intensive care, laboratory departments, and operating rooms, and included installation of a new emergency backup generator, renovation of its emergency room and patient rooms, and helped create a bone marrow transplant program. |
![]() |
Children's also used these bonds to acquire a nearby building-the Martin Luther King Plaza-to house research activities. Authority funding helped the organization renovate this former public school into research facilities. In a separate transaction, the Authority issued $30 million for Children's in connection with a major seismic retrofit project. |
